NextFin News - In a move that signals a definitive shift in the Android philosophy, Google has begun rolling out a series of technical updates designed to make the sideloading of third-party applications significantly more difficult on Google TV and Android mobile platforms. According to Cord Cutters News, the tech giant is increasingly utilizing the Play Integrity API to verify that apps are installed via the official Google Play Store, effectively blocking or complicating the installation of APK files from external sources. This transition, which reached a critical implementation phase in mid-January 2026, affects millions of users globally who rely on sideloading for niche applications, older software versions, or services not hosted on the official store.

The mechanism behind this restriction involves a sophisticated multi-layered verification process. When a user attempts to install an application from an unofficial source, the system now triggers aggressive security warnings and, in many cases, requires the developer to have integrated specific integrity tokens that are only granted through the Play Store ecosystem. This change is not merely a software update but a fundamental pivot in how Google manages its operating system. For years, the ability to sideload was a hallmark of Android’s competitive advantage over Apple’s iOS. However, the current landscape suggests that Google is prioritizing ecosystem security and monetization over the traditional open-source flexibility that defined its early growth.

From a strategic standpoint, the tightening of sideloading capabilities is driven by three primary factors: security, revenue protection, and regulatory alignment. By forcing users into the Play Store, Google ensures that all applications adhere to its safety standards, reducing the risk of malware and ransomware that often propagate through unverified APKs. More importantly, this move secures Google’s 15% to 30% commission on in-app purchases. As the streaming market matures, Google TV has become a vital battleground for ad revenue and subscription cuts. Sideloaded apps often bypass these monetization channels, representing a direct leak in Google’s financial pipeline. Furthermore, the impact on the Google TV ecosystem is particularly acute. The rise of unauthorized streaming services—often installed via sideloading—has long been a thorn in the side of major media conglomerates. By making it harder to install these "gray market" apps, Google is positioning itself as a more reliable partner for content creators and traditional broadcasters. This move is expected to drive higher engagement with licensed services like YouTube TV, Netflix, and Disney+, which in turn boosts Google’s data collection capabilities. In the digital economy, data is the ultimate currency, and a closed loop allows Google to track user behavior with surgical precision, enhancing its targeted advertising algorithms.

Looking ahead, the industry should expect a "cat and mouse" game between independent developers and Google’s security engineers. While power users will likely find workarounds, the average consumer will find the friction of sideloading too high to bother. This will lead to a further consolidation of the app market, where smaller developers are forced to comply with Google’s terms or face obsolescence. The trend suggests that by 2027, the distinction between Android and iOS in terms of installation flexibility will be almost non-existent. As Google continues to integrate AI-driven security features into the Play Integrity API, the era of the "open" Android ecosystem is rapidly drawing to a close, replaced by a highly curated, secure, and monetized digital environment.
